Indulgent Warm Apple Date Treacle Cake with Butter Sauce Delight Recipe

Description

This Indulgent Warm Apple Date Treacle Cake with Butter Sauce Delight is a comforting and richly flavored dessert perfect for cozy evenings. Combining the natural sweetness of soaked dates, fresh apples, warm spices, and a luscious butter sauce, this cake offers a moist texture with a depth of flavor that delights every bite. The optional nuts add a pleasant crunch, making it an unforgettable treat.


Ingredients

Scale

Cake Ingredients

  • 2 cups Pitted Dates, chopped (Substitute with chopped dried apricots or figs for a different flavor.)
  • 2 cups Boiling Water (Used to soak the dates, enhancing their softness.)
  • 1 cup Unsalted Butter, softened (Use plant-based butter for a dairy-free version.)
  • 1 cup Brown Sugar, packed (Adjust down for a less sweet cake or use coconut sugar.)
  • 3 large Eggs (For a vegan version, replace with flax eggs.)
  • 2 teaspoons Vanilla Extract
  • 2 cups All-Purpose Flour (For gluten-free, substitute with gluten-free flour blend.)
  • 1 teaspoon Baking Powder
  • 1 teaspoon Baking Soda
  • 2 teaspoons Ground Cinnamon (Try adding nutmeg for a different touch.)
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 3 medium Apples, peeled, cored, and diced (Use a mix of tart and sweet apples.)
  • 1 cup Chopped Walnuts or Pecans (optional) (Omit for a nut-free option.)

Butter Sauce Ingredients

  • 1 cup Unsalted Butter (Melt for a rich finish.)
  • 1 cup Brown Sugar
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ream (Can use coconut cream for a non-dairy option.)
  • 2 teaspoons Vanilla Extract


Instructions

  1. Soak Dates: Place the chopped pitted dates in a bowl and pour over 2 cups of boiling water. Let them soak for about 15 minutes until softened, which helps to naturally sweeten and moisten the cake.
  2. Prepare the Batter: In a large mixing bowl, cream together 1 cup softened unsalted butter and 1 cup packed brown s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in the 3 large eggs one at a time, ensuring each is fully incorporated. Add 2 teaspoons vanilla extract and mix well.
  3.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, sift together 2 cups all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on baking powder, 1 teaspoon baking soda, 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on, and 1 teaspoon salt. Gradually add these d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ing gently to avoid overworking the batter.
  4. Add Soaked Dates and Apples: Drain the soaked dates, reserving the soaking liquid. Chop the dates finely if needed and fold them into the batter along with the diced apples and optional chopped walnuts or pecans for texture and flavor.
  5. Prepare to Bake: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9-inch or 8-inch square cake pan. Pour the batter evenly into the prepared pan, smoothing the top with a spatula.
  6. Bake the Cake: Place the cake in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Remove from oven and let it cool slightly in the pan.
  7. Make Butter Sauce: While the cake is baking, prepare the butter sauce. In a saucepan over medium heat, melt 1 cup unsalted butter with 1 cup brown sugar. Stir continuously until the sugar dissolves and the mixture starts bubbling. Slowly whisk in 1 cup heavy cream and 2 teaspoons vanilla extract, cooking for a few minutes until the sauce thickens slightly.
  8. Serve: Once the cake is slightly cooled, cut into 8–8 slices and serve warm. Pour generous amounts of the butter sauce over each slice for a decadent finish.

Notes

  • Substitute chopped dried apricots or figs for dates for a different fruity flavor.
  • Use plant-based butter and flax eggs to make a vegan-friendly version.
  • For gluten-free options, swap all-purpose flour with a gluten-free blend.
  • Adjust brown sugar quantity as preferred to reduce sweetness.
  • Nuts can be omitted to accommodate nut allergies.
  • Use coconut cream in place of heavy cream to make the sauce dairy-free.
  • Be sure not to overmix the batter to keep the cake light and moist.
